Bootstrapping a new blockchain network has always been one of crypto's hardest problems. You need validators to secure the network, but validators need economic incentives — and you can't offer credible incentives until you have a network worth securing. It's a classic cold-start problem.
EigenLayer proposes an elegant solution: let Ethereum stakers extend their cryptoeconomic security to new networks, called Actively Validated Services (AVSs). Instead of locking up new capital for each protocol, restakers can reuse their staked ETH to secure multiple systems simultaneously.
How Restaking Works
When you stake ETH on Ethereum, you're locking capital and agreeing to run honest validator software. EigenLayer adds an additional opt-in layer: restakers signal that their staked ETH can also be slashed if they misbehave on AVS networks. In return, they earn additional rewards from those networks.
AVSs are diverse: oracle networks, data availability layers, bridges, sequencer sets, and threshold cryptography systems are all candidate applications. Any service that currently requires its own validator set and token-based security could potentially leverage Ethereum's existing $50B+ in staked ETH instead.
The Risks: Slashing and Systemic Correlation
Restaking is not free money. The primary risk is compounding slashing exposure — if a restaker is slashed on multiple AVSs simultaneously, they can lose a significant portion of their staked ETH. More systemic is the risk of correlated failures: if a bug or exploit causes mass slashing across many AVSs that share the same restaker set, it could destabilize Ethereum's validator economics.
EigenLayer's design includes slashing conditions and operator reputation systems to mitigate these risks, but the complexity is real. As with all novel primitives, the risk/reward calculus depends heavily on implementation quality and the specific AVSs a restaker opts into.
Why We're Watching EigenLayer Closely
The potential upside is enormous: a shared security marketplace that dramatically lowers the cost of launching credible decentralized networks. If EigenLayer works as designed, it could compress the bootstrapping timeline for new crypto infrastructure from years to months.
